Rational of Sensorial Activities

January 26th, 2007

The aim of sensorial materials is the education and refinement of the senses: visual, tactile, auditory, olfactory, gustatory, thermic, baric, sterognostic, and chromatic.

These activities assist the child in the development of his intelligence, which is dependent upon the organizing and categorizing of his sense perceptions into an inner mental order.

Again, you don’t really need a prescribed set of materials to do this, it’s impractical to buy the whole set of Montessori apparatus to educate your own kids.
